Poultry, red meat stocks get tighter

The USDA says red meat stocks in cold storage at the end of June 2021 were 868.757 million pounds, down 8% on the year.

Beef was reported at 398.66 million pounds, a year to year decline of 7% with a 1% increase in monthly production, while pork was 442.145 million pounds, 4% less than last year despite a 5% decrease in monthly production.

Poultry in cold storage came out at 1.147 billion pounds, 15% below a year ago, with chicken at 738.368 million pounds, a drop of 15%, and turkey at 406.008 million pounds, a decrease of 14%. The turkey total included record monthly lows for whole hens, legs, and “unclassified”.

The USDA’s next set of annual meat production estimates is out August 12th.
